Overview / Job Summary:

Are you seeking a revitalizing opportunity in the healthcare field? Join us as we guide our students in obtaining their certificates in the Practical Nursing (PN) program, paving their way toward nursing degrees and careers. This position offers a dynamic blend of clinical and classroom environments, allowing you to share your expertise and insights from the healthcare sector to enhance our students' success and employability, potentially leading them to work alongside you in life-saving roles!

Your daily respon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Overseeing and directing students in all assigned classroom and laboratory activities to ensure a safe and productive learning space.
  • Keeping students informed regarding course content, requirements, assessment procedures, and attendance expectations.
  • Ensuring that each program/class includes essential curricular components, maintains appropriate content and teaching methods, and stays current. You will maintain a high level of expertise in the subjects taught and inspire enthusiasm among students.
  • Assessing students to track their progress toward achieving course outcomes and competencies.
  • Developing, revising, and recommending curriculum changes that align with course/program objectives and enhance student learning.

Requirements

Education:

  • Associates Degree in Nursing, required, with a Bachelor's degree preferred (must be willing to commence BSN within one year).

Preferred Qualifications:

  • One year of experience as a registered nurse, preferred.
  • A minimum of five years in nursing, nurse education, nurse practitioner roles, or related experience, required.
  • Must possess a current, unrestricted Kansas RN license.
  • Obtain, at personal expense, annual TB tests and other required immunizations or physical exams for clinical placements. Additionally, a CPR certification is required prior to clinical assignments.
  • Previous teaching or training experience in adult education preferred.
